Times Internet Limited (TIL), the digital division of the Times Group, has laid off over 120 employees in the past three days, sources told exchange4media.
This marks the second round of layoffs at TIL, following the loss of 100 jobs in August, despite earlier assurances of that being a "one-time exercise".
The recent layoffs, done discreetly through individual phone calls, took employees by surprise, with no prior communication to vertical heads, the sources said.
The affected employees, spanning various verticals, were reportedly given three-month severance packages, and their email addresses were promptly terminated.
Insiders speculate that the layoffs are part of a broader integration process ahead of the Times Group’s split between the Jain brothers.
